How Us Dollar Index Yahoo Works — A Clear, Factual Overview
The Us Dollar Index (USDX) measures the value of the US dollar against a basket of major currencies, including the euro, yen, pound, Swiss franc, and others. Unlike individual currency conversions, it offers a standardized snapshot of dollar strength across global markets. H2: How Is the Us Dollar Index Measured?
The index uses a weighted geometric average of currency exchange rates. Each currency in the basket carries a weight based on its relative trade importance with the US. H2: What Influences Movements in the Us Dollar Index Yahoo?
Key drivers include US interest rate policies, inflation dynamics, global economic stability, and shifts in foreign exchange markets. For example, anticipated Fed rate hikes often boost dollar strength, while strong GDP data from the U.S. enhances confidence. What People Often Get Wrong About the Us Dollar Index
A common misconception: the index alone predicts economic health or stock performance. In reality, it reflects a snapshot of current monetary conditions and expectations. Another misunderstanding is equating short-term index swings with long-term value — real stability comes from sustained economic fundamentals, not daily fluctuations.
